Reykjavik to Light Up for Winter
Travellers planning trips to cheap hotels in Reykjavik this winter will be treated to quite a sight as the sky over Iceland is lit up by two phenomena one natural and the other man-made.
Yoko Ono will visit Reykjavik this month to relight the Imagine Peace Tower on Videy Island for its second year.
This 20-metre-high beam of white light will be switched on from October 9th, John Lennon's birthday, to December 8th, the date of his death.
Visitors can see the tower, which is inscribed with the words 'imagine peace' in 24 languages, by catching ferries to Videy Island from Reykjavik's Skarfabakki pier every day at 20:00.
Another impressive sight that visitors to Iceland may witness is the Northern Lights, which can be seen from the country between October and March.
Iceland's close proximity to the North Pole means that the Northern Lights, which is a natural display of multicoloured light in the sky, can be seen on clear evenings when the temperature is below zero degrees Celsius.
